Man charged with intoxication manslaughter after 17-vehicle Texas crash results in 5 fatalities


A man in Austin, Texas was charged with intoxication manslaughter after a late-night wreck on Interstate 35 involved 17 vehicles, resulting in the deaths of five people – three adults, a child, and an infant. Eleven others were injured in the crash. Solomun Weldekeal Araya, 37, faces five counts of intoxication manslaughter and two counts of intoxication assault. The southbound lanes of I-35 were closed for hours following the crash, which left a scene of mangled vehicles and debris. Authorities have not released details on what caused the wreck, stating that the investigation is still ongoing. Police Officer Austin Zarling described the collision as “very large and very complex.” Eyewitness Edgar Viera described the scene as heartbreaking, as he and others tried to help those involved without the proper tools to open the vehicles. The southbound lanes of I-35 were reopened around 1 p.m. following the crash that occurred just before 11:30 p.m. the previous night. Araya remains in custody in Travis County Jail, and it is unclear if he has an attorney at this time.
